The Use of Tobacco and Drinks Containing Alcohol Can Complicate Dental Problems.
Tobacco stains the teeth and increases the risk of gum disease and tooth loss. Drinks containing alcohol, and the mixers used with them, often contain lots of sugar, increasing the risk of tooth decay. Studies have also shown that drinking alcohol and smoking or chewing tobacco are also associated with an increased risk of developing mouth cancer.
